Inflatable Water Ball Lets You Walk On Water

[youtube]http://www.youtube.com/watch?v=BqbzMpeDfFk&eurl=http://inventorspot.com/articles/human_hamster_ball_makes_walking_rolling_water_reality_21921&feature=player_embedded[/youtube] 

Shinra Manufacturers of Guangzhou, China has made it possible for you to walk on water with the Inflatable Water Ball.  Now, I’m all for the idea of being able to walk on water.  Really, I am.  I think it would be pretty cool in a nondenominational deity sort of way.  But…

Continue reading… “Inflatable Water Ball Lets You Walk On Water”